Troon 2-3 Camelford

Troon gave the SWPL Prem side a run for their money on sat, and ended up feeling hard done by after the game, which goes to show they matched Camelford throughout the game. The pitch was obviously going to be a tad "sticky..." but this is the same for both teams. Camelford took the lead on the 12th Min when their No 9 slotted in from close range following a bit of a scramble in the goal mouth, Troon were back on level terms on the 18th Min when Chris Woods chipped a lovely ball through for Steve proctor to run onto and chip the ball over the on coming keeper, 5 mins later Steve was brought down a yard inside of the box, the keeper given a yellow as the ref seemed to think he was heading away from goal, he then said the free kick was direct....much to the confusion of the players, he then stated the foul was not inside the box, but on the line, which is in isn't it.....!? (a decision which could of changed the game/result!) troon got on with it and had to bite their lip, but 5 mins later a good shot from the edge of the box put Camelford 2-1 up going into HT.

Troon would of took going into HT 2-1 down before the game, but the 1st 45 mins was as even matched as it was going to get from 2 teams as this stage of the comp, so came out of the changing rooms all guns blazing, and on the 60th min got their well deserved equaliser when Jamie Marles was brought down inside of the box, Ashley Smeeth, returning from a dislocated knee, grabbed the ball and smashed it into the net to square things up, game on! the last 30 mins was frantic, with both teams creating chances, but Craig Clinton was on form for the home side as was the away keeper. On the 85th min a corner was swung in and met by a Camelford defender who powered the header past the home keeps to win the game for them. All in all Troon came come out of the game with their heads held high, knowing they pushed a Prem team that will be there or there abouts this season right to the end, and in a way i'm glad Troon got to go out like this, rather than an away game later on in the stages on a week night!! i'm sure Camelford will do well in this cup, and from all at Troon we wish them all the best for the rest of the season.
